## Overview

The BalanceFrom Bike Trainer Stand is a robust, alloy steel magnetic resistance trainer designed for serious cyclists seeking a stable, quiet, and customizable indoor workout. Supporting up to 330 lbs and compatible with most 26-28" and 700C wheel bikes, it features 8 resistance levels controlled via a handlebar-mounted dial and a quick-release clamp for easy bike mounting. Its wide base and rubber feet protect floors while delivering a realistic cycling experience, making it a top budget-friendly choice for year-round training.

Review: Excellent product for the money! Recommended! - I was somewhat reluctant to purchase this based on some of the product reviews, but I rolled the dice and was NOT disappointed! Let me refute some claims in other reviews: (A) It is VERY easy to assemble. There is ONE bolt to install the resistance wheel to the trainer frame. The instructions are pictorial only, but every screw, washer, bolt, and tool (included) are labelled. If you can follow "align bolt A with washer B into hole C and tighten with bolt D", you'll be fine. Its not rocket science. After attaching the resistance wheel to the trainer frame, be sure to align the tightening screw (with the big nob) into the bolt on the resistance wheel. Again, its not rocket science. (B) Attaching your bike to the trainer frame might be a little awkward the first time, especially if you are doing it by yourself, but its not difficult. After you get it right, removing the bike and reattaching it is easy. With some bikes, you may have to replace the axle pin (included), but I did not have to do that. My 25 year old mountain bike attached fine the first time. RECOMMENDATION: Do not rush this step or you may find your bike slipping out of the trainer frame and you flying across room on your moving bike!. (C) A front wheel stabilizer IS included. Once my bike (with 26" mountain bike tires) was attached in the trainer frame, the front wheel sat 3" above the ground and the real wheel sat about 2" above the ground. I am using this in my basement with 7' ceilings and still have headroom when I ride. (D) Noise. Its not silent, but I would not describe it as "noisy" either. I would compare the noise to that of a someone using a vacuum cleaner on the floor above you. Its more of a "drone" or a "whir". Pitch varies with speed and - for me - at a low-moderate speed the noise definitely gets more pronounced, but is less so at low, moderate, and higher speeds. My trainer sits on a "commercial" type carpet that you'd find in an office building. To say one needs "noise-cancelling headphones to watch TV while riding" seems way out of whack with what I am experiencing. (E) An adjustment dial can be attached to your handlebars, nut it does not do much (I'll agree with that!) but - once I set the base resistance using the nob at the back of the resistance wheel (while I am off the bike), I am able to use my front and rear derailleurs to adjust resistance somewhat (its not as pronounced as when you are riding on the road, though). You can then use adjustment dial to make small resistance adjustments within a gear (if that makes any sense). NOTE: I used 2 or 3 small Velcro straps to attach the adjustment cable to the frame. This is not necessary if you plan on using your bike in- and out-doors, or moving the bike between uses...but I plan on keeping it where it is until spring/summer, so the Velcro just keeps things tight and tidy. (F) The workout: Call me Captain Obvious, but the higher the resistance you set initially will determine how hard you work. I'm still playing with it to find the right setting. What feels "right" at first may be too tough to sustain. My first workout kicked my butt. You will likely find yourself making many small adjustments at first until you find your "sweet spot" BOTTOM LINE: Looking for a budget bike trainer, this is the one. There is nothing out there less expensive than this. Its sturdy AND it does the job. Are there better, quieter, more feature-rich units out there? Sure...but a 2 or 3 times the cost, or more! If you are looking to buy an inexpensive indoor bike trainer to help lose your COVID-15, this is definitely worth the investment, IMHO

## Questions & Answers

**Q: I have quick release hubs.  Will this work without changing out the axle?  The video shows changing out the axle even though it had quick release hubs**
A: Yes, works with quick release axle without having to change anything. Super quick mounting of the bike to the stand. Literally from the box to riding on the stand in less than 5 minutes.

**Q: Will this trainer work on an older bike without quick release axel? I tried a Unisky and the right bolt holder didn’t fit on my bikes’s bolt.**
A: I have an older bike as well without quick release and it worked great! The bolts on my axle fit right in and I was able to tighten and stabilize without any problems.

**Q: how do you adjust the speeds? Mine does absolutely nothing. :(**
A: By "speeds" I assume you mean "resistance" against pedaling.  There is a cable and a gearshift-like lever attached to the generator that must be attached to the stand.  Make sure the generator's 
roller (shiny metallic cylinder) pushes against the rear tire, and turns as the rear wheel turns.
If that is the case, then changing settings on the lever mentioned above will change resistance to pedaling.

**Q: Can i use this on my bike without qr axel? i just have bolts on each side of my mountain bike.**
A: NO- this will destroy your frame. Order a bolt axle to use instead of the QR they provide you with. Make sure you measure your bolt axle before ordering a trainer bolt axle.
